If you are trying to optimize your site to improve your search ranking, it's important to make sure that your site's code is clean and well written. If your site uses primarily JavaScript for content, for example, and the code is messy, the search engine spiders will be unable to index it. Using Flash without textual descriptions makes it impossible to index your site.

If you are wanting to make the most of search engine optimization, then you need a site map describing your website. If you have a site map a search engine can find you easily. Extremely large sites may require more than just one site map. A good rule of thumb is to not have lots of links on each site map.

If you utilize audio or video as part of your website's content mix, consider including transcripts as part of the post. When you give a transcript, the search engine will find it as well.

Use keyword-friendly anchor text for links between pages on your website. Do not just put "click here" because this will not do anything for SEO. Spiders focus on keywords, so if you pick out the most appropriate keywords for your content, they will count your anchor text towards your overall relevancy.

If you believe your article promotion strategy requires more exposure for your articles, consider buying in to an article distribution service. These services have a network of directories set up and will send your article through this network, which may number in the thousands. They cost money, though, and you should calculate whether the money spent is worth the added exposure.
